The Hindu Business Line is the leading resource on Indian business. It is a financial and business daily newspaper published by Kasturi and sons Limited, also popularly known as The Hindu Group of Publications. The company also publishes The Hindu, one of India's most respected daily newspapers; Sportstar, a weekly sports magazine; and, Frontline, a fortnightly current affairs magazine.
